The S.S. John W. Brown next month will make two stops in Massachusetts and one in Maine.Baltimore-based Project Liberty Ship has announced that the World War II-era vessel will visit (in order) Buzzards Bay, Mass. (August 13-15); Portland, Maine (August 16-22); and Boston (August 23-28). The voyage is themed “Yankee Adventure 2007.”
The public is invited to board the vessel for dock-side tours of the ship in each port. In addition, Project Liberty Ship will conduct “Living History Cruises” from Portland and Boston.
The Brown tentatively is scheduled to sail from Baltimore on August 11 and will return to its home port on August 30.
